1.0 Introduction
Treatment planning in radiotherapy is the structured process of designing, calculating,
optimizing, and verifying the delivery of therapeutic radiation to achieve maximum tumor
control with minimal toxicity. Modern radiotherapy techniques—including IMRT, VMAT,
SBRT, SRS, and proton therapy—depend on sophisticated planning workflows and
imaging systems.
2.0 Treatment Planning Workflow
A standard radiotherapy planning workflow includes:
1. Patient simulation (CT/MRI/PET)
2. Image registration and fusion
3. Contouring: GTV, CTV, PTV, OARs
4. Beam setup (energy, geometry, modifiers)
5. Dose calculation in TPS
6. Optimization (inverse/forward)
7. Plan evaluation (DVH, indices)
8. QA verification
9. Treatment delivery
